brooklyn.management
Interface ExecutionContext

All Superinterfaces:
Executor

public interface ExecutionContext
extends Executor

This is a Brooklyn extension to the Java Executor.


Method Summary
 Task<?> getCurrentTask()
          Returns the current Task being executed by this context.
 Set<Task<?>> getTasks()
           
<T> Task<T>
submit(Map<?,?> properties, Callable<T> callable)
           
 Task<?> submit(Map<?,?> properties, Runnable runnable)
           
<T> Task<T>
submit(Task<T> task)
           
 
Methods inherited from interface java.util.concurrent.Executor
execute
 

Method Detail

getCurrentTask

Task<?> getCurrentTask()
Returns the current Task being executed by this context.


getTasks

Set<Task<?>> getTasks()

submit

Task<?> submit(Map<?,?> properties,
               Runnable runnable)

submit

<T> Task<T> submit(Map<?,?> properties,
                   Callable<T> callable)

submit

<T> Task<T> submit(Task<T> task)


Copyright © 2013. All Rights Reserved.